OREANDA-NEWS. During his visit to Ukraine, the High Representative of the European Union (EU) for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y Josep Borrell will not discuss Nord Stream 2. Borrell himself said this on January 4 in an interview with the Polish Press Agency (PAP).

Borrell noted that German regulators are now dealing with the SP-2 issue.

“We are now focusing all our efforts on defusing tensions and preventing a worsening of the situation,” Borrell said, speaking of the goals of his visit to Ukraine.

Borrell's working visit to Ukraine takes place from 4 to 6 January. In addition, it is noted that Borrel, accompanied by Ukrainian Foreign Minister Dmitry Kuleba, will visit the contact line in Donbass. The EU High Representative will then meet with the Ukrainian authorities.

Earlier, on January 2, US President Joe Biden and Ukrainian leader Volodymyr Zelenskyy discussed measures to support Ukraine's sovereignty and territorial integrity during a telephone conversation. During the conversation, the owner of the White House expressed his adherence to the principle of "nothing about you without you" in relation to Kiev, and also announced Washington's support for the sovereignty and territorial integrity of Ukraine.

In addition, the American leader noted that the United States, its allies and partners will give a decisive response in the event of an aggravation of the situation on the Ukrainian border.
